Cloud native is as we speak’s cloud computing. It focuses on constructing and deploying functions, delivered to finish customers through the cloud mannequin. Moreover, it supplies advantages similar to scalability, flexibility, and resilience.
Being cloud-native reduces the prices and appreciable investments that conventional infrastructure requires, and it encompasses the deployment of microservices packaged into containers. (To study the fundamentals of cloud native, learn our weblog publish What Is Cloud Native?; it additionally explains cloud-native structure.)
What Are Conventional Analytics?
Analytics reveals and detects significant patterns in information for enterprise processes, similar to monitoring the corporate’s efficiency, pinpointing strengths and weaknesses, after which informing data-driven choices. Analytics is carried out through numerous instruments or platforms which may be embedded into the present firm’s answer.
Web site, finance, and gross sales information are probably the most generally tracked enterprise areas:
- Web site analytics: To be able to enhance person expertise and profitability, web site analytics helps corporations to establish and perceive gadgets similar to web site visitors, customer preferences, and bounce price.
- Monetary analytics: Monetary analytics focuses on the prices and revenues of the corporate.
- Gross sales analytics: Gross sales analytics assists in managing shoppers and prospects, and evaluating gross sales throughout numerous areas; it additionally signifies essential developments that may help within the growth of a simpler gross sales technique.
What Is Cloud-Native Analytics, and How Can It Be Deployed?
To place it merely, cloud-native analytics seeks to supply basically the identical consequence as conventional analytics: the evaluation of knowledge to generate dependable stories that advise future business-critical choices.
Nevertheless, whereas conventional analytics takes the type of one, inflexible platform — typically solely presenting the details of the present scenario — cloud-native analytics takes full benefit of cloud computing. It runs in a container-based structure and subsequently reduces peculiar {hardware} prices and managerial duties. Finally, it helps corporations extra successfully scale their enterprise.
Deploying cloud-native analytics may be completed via various kinds of clouds. Listed below are the primary three varieties:
- Public cloud: This shares cloud companies amongst prospects, whereby information and functions are securely separated from different customers.
- Personal cloud: Because the title suggests, a non-public cloud is restricted to a given buyer. It delivers the next degree of safety and privateness through firewalls, stopping third events from accessing delicate information.
- Hybrid cloud: A hybrid cloud refers to a computing atmosphere that mixes non-public and public clouds, permitting for the sharing of knowledge and software between them.

Picture credit score: thymos.engineering
How Does Cloud Analytics Work?
Cloud analytics relies on a software program system hosted through the web, with the system operating on servers in a distant information heart. The method of acquiring information for advanced stories takes place in three fundamental steps:
- Information administration: Customers accumulate information concerning the efficiency of their enterprise. This information has an assigned kind and construction saved in information warehouses instantly related to the cloud, accessible from wherever.
- Information analytics: Quite a lot of back-end processes put together numerous composable views on associated information at a big scale. They make future predictions quicker and extra successfully primarily based on real-time analytics and predefined measures.
- Analytics distribution: To retailer and distribute information and outcomes through the cloud, corporations scale rapidly and simply. The analytical software helps information visualization via insights.
The Variations Between Cloud-Native Analytics and Analytics
Compared to its conventional counterpart, cloud-native analytics requires far much less work to arrange and keep. This is because of the truth that the cloud supplier is liable for a lot of the infrastructure-related heavy lifting.
One other plus for cloud native is that of the standardized strategies and interface employed, leading to growth that’s significantly extra accessible to finish customers. On high of those advantages, cloud-native analytics is ready to totally change conventional analytics with the added advantages that cloud computing naturally supplies.
Conventional Analytics | Cloud-Native Analytics |
---|---|
Requires a totally operated structure | Runs on servers managed by cloud suppliers |
Usually positioned on computer systems | Accessible anytime from wherever |
Frequent troubleshooting outages | Updates or bug fixes may be deployed with out limitation of finish customers |
Elements of analytics are composed multi functional piece | Companies run in separated microservices packed in containers |
Steady deployment is tough and managed manually | Simple deployment via present processes similar to CICD pipelines, and many others. |
Troublesome to scale on account of totally different modules which have competing useful resource necessities | Simply scalable by way of storages and sources, relying on numerous firm necessities |
Depends on caching and copying information | Constructed for real-time evaluation |
It helps to resolve in line with a speculation | Evaluation primarily based on goal views to make an neutral choice |
Cloud-Native Analytical Platform With GoodData
GoodData presents prospects a cloud-native analytical platform: GoodData.CN. GoodData’s cloud-native platform makes use of Docker containers and microservices operating on Kubernetes clusters to dynamically develop analytics on demand.
To be able to present software builders with as many compute and storage sources as they will afford, whether or not in a public cloud or on-premises IT atmosphere, GoodData.CN makes use of Kubernetes’ orchestration capabilities. To be extra particular, the answer works with a Helm chart for various cloud suppliers — or, in different phrases, a bunch of information that designate a set of related Kubernetes sources. Moreover, prospects can set up GoodData.CN to totally different cloud storage options similar to Amazon Net Companies, Google Cloud Platform, and Microsoft Azure Cloud.
One of many main advantages of GoodData.CN is its potential to supply a programmatically managed and managed headless analytics answer. Customers can connect with the analytics engine, construct a semantic information layer on the highest of a knowledge supply’s — or mixed information supply’s — bodily information mannequin, after which create customized metrics. GoodData helps creating metrics through its personal multi-dimensional question language, MAQL. (For extra data on MAQL, try the GoodData College course.) Afterward, customized analytics insights and dashboards may be constructed on high of the MAQL-based metrics and embedded into an software or internet portal, or utilized within the desired analytics use case.
Furthermore, GoodData’s headless BI engine helps the consumption and visualization of knowledge from any third-party software, with self-service analytical instruments empowering technical and non-technical customers to customise their very own information visualizations. This customization perform may be facilitated via all the usual channels, similar to protocols (JDBC, ODBC), SDKs, or open APIs. (To search out out extra details about GoodData.CN, learn this Medium publish on headless BI.)

GoodData.CN supplies many advantages, together with the flexibility to:
- Run concurrently with out limiting finish customers
- Present a deployable analytical engine wherever
- Be deployed in a public or non-public cloud
- Retailer and handle workspaces as particular person objects
- Present real-time analytics instantly related to a person’s information sources
Able to Study Extra?
To study extra about cloud-native analytics, check out GoodData.CN Group Version, a cloud-native answer out there as a single container Docker picture. It’s also possible to deploy and handle your self-service analytics through the use of certainly one of our plans. Our documentation is one other nice useful resource.